Homemade Personalized Birthday Bingo

April 23rd, 2009 · No Comments

Personalized and easy and cheap…  That’s how I like the activities at the birthday parties I plan.

Birthday Bingo is lots of fun.  I like to make a new bingo game for each kids birthday.  Its very simple using just a word document and images from the internet.

  1. Open a word document and make a table (in my example I use 4×4, drag to fill up the page).
  2. Go to www.images.google.com and pick out your child’s favorite items or pictures related to the birthday theme (in my example, the party theme was “bugs”, I included his initial and his number- aka age, and his favorite cartoon characters and superheroes).
  3. Print one copy, then rotate the images so each bingo boards is different and print another.  Repeat until you have enough for all the guests.  (For older kids, you can have extra images to swap in and out, but for the littlest kids, you want to avoid a meltdown if their card doesn’t have the character that another kid has.)
  4. Print an extra copy and cut apart (the bingo caller needs this for calling the game).

We use poker chips to mark the squares for the little kids, food items are fun too (like smarties).
